KDM7A and KDM1A inhibition suppresses tumour promoting pathways in prostate cancer
Treatment resistance is a major challenge for patients with advanced prostate cancer. This study examined an alternative approach to target the major prostate cancer‐promoting pathway by targeting epigenetic factors, whose levels are higher in tumours.

MagmaFlow: A desktop platform for artificial intelligence‐driven expression analysis
MagmaFlow is a free, no‐code platform for gene expression analysis. It generates interactive volcano plots, links genes to literature, pathways, and diseases, prioritizes candidates using millions of publications, identifies affected biological processes, builds network diagrams, and exports publication‐ready figures and reports for macOS and Windows ...

Efficacy of Inebilizumab in N‐MOmentum Trial Participants With or Without Prior Immunosuppressants
ABSTRACT This post hoc analysis examined the impact of prior immunosuppressants on the long‐term efficacy and safety of inebilizumab, a cluster of differentiation 19+ B‐cell–depleting monoclonal antibody, in participants with aquaporin‐4–seropositive neuromyelitis optica spectrum disorder from the N‐MOmentum trial (NTC02200770).
